Only three of the original ten chestnuts are still alive. Perhaps the worst part of that is that two of the three are &#8220;tree&#8221;, as opposed to &#8220;nut&#8221;, type trees &#8212; that is, they were bred for growing to impressive trees rather than for producing big crops. I had started with five of each type. That was more than there really was space for, and I wouldn&#8217;t have minded a 50% survival rate, but I was hoping for more like three &#8220;nut&#8221; trees and two &#8220;tree&#8221; ones.<\/p>\n<p>The hazels are doing much better than the chestnuts, maybe 14 survivors of the original 22 plants. They haven&#8217;t put on much height, and some of the survivors don&#8217;t have as many leaves as they started with, but several of them are growing well. If they put down good root systems and come back next year I&#8217;ll be happy.<\/p>\n<p>I got both my small gasoline engines started without trouble.
